

Bill was born in Adair, OK, October 29, 1923 and passed away at McKee Medical Center January 21, 2012. He graduated from Norwood H.S., Norwood, CO and from Grand Junction Business School. He was drafted into the U.S. Army soon after the beginning of WWII. He attended CSU for 3 ½ years and graduated from the University of Washington. Bill remained active in some form of the Military for 36 years, retiring as a Major in the U.S. Air Force. He worked in construction, was a resident Engineer at the Climax Molybdenum Co., near Leadville. He retired from the City and County of Denver.
Bill was a charter member of the Pipe Band of El Jebel Shrine, playing the bagpipes for nearly 40 years. He was an avid outdoorsman, who spent 20 years as a National Ski Patrolman. He enjoyed all sports, as well as bow hunting, fly fishing and camping with his sons, other family members and friends.
